The slope of the budget line plays a key role in understanding trade-offs and opportunity costs.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Let\u2019s denote: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>$P_x$ = price of the good on the horizontal axis (Good X),<\/li>\n\n\n\n<li>$P_y$ = price of the good on the vertical axis (Good Y),<\/li>\n\n\n\n<li>$I$ = income of the consumer.<\/li>\n<\/ul>\n\n\n\n<p class=\"wp-block-paragraph\">The budget line equation is: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">$$<br>P_x X + P_y Y = I<br>$$<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">To express the budget line in terms of Y (vertical axis), solve for $Y$: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">$$<br>Y = \\frac{I}{P_y} &#8211; \\frac{P_x}{P_y}X<br>$$<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">The slope of the budget line is: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">$$<br>-\\frac{P_x}{P_y}<br>$$<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">This negative slope indicates the trade-off between the two goods. Specifically, the <strong>magnitude<\/strong> of the slope ($\\frac{P_x}{P_y}$) shows <strong>how many units of the good on the vertical axis (Good Y)<\/strong> a consumer must give up to obtain <strong>one more unit of the good on the horizontal axis (Good X)<\/strong>. In simpler terms, the slope quantifies the <strong>opportunity cost<\/strong> of consuming more of Good X in terms of how much of Good Y must be sacrificed.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Therefore, <strong>the magnitude of the slope tells us the opportunity cost of the good on the horizontal axis (Good X) in terms of the good on the vertical axis (Good Y)<\/strong>.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Choices <strong>C<\/strong> and <strong>D<\/strong>, referring to <strong>price elasticity<\/strong>, are unrelated here because elasticity measures responsiveness to price changes, not budget constraints.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Choice <strong>B<\/strong> is incorrect because it reverses the direction of the opportunity cost being measured by the slope.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<p class=\"wp-block-paragraph\"><strong>Conclusion<\/strong>: The correct interpretation of the slope of the budget line is that it measures the <strong>opportunity cost of the good on the horizontal axis in terms of the good on the vertical axis<\/strong>, making <strong>Option A<\/strong> the correct answer.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>The magnitude of the slope of the budget line measures the A) opportunity cost of the good on the horizontal axis in terms of the good on the vertical axis.
